Role OverviewWe are looking for a capable System Administrator to manage, secure, and operate our enterprise Windows and Linux server environments. This role ensures reliability, security, and performance across core infrastructure, virtualization, storage, backups, and observability.
Responsibilities- Provision, configure, and operate Windows Server & Linux hosts, including golden images, baselines, and CIS hardening.
- Execute patch management and vulnerability remediation; maintain health of EDR, monitoring, and backup agents at scale.
- Administer Active Directory/Group Policy and integrate SSO (LDAP/SAML/OIDC) for servers and applications.
- Manage virtualization platforms: clusters, templates, snapshots, performance, and capacity planning.
- Operate storage & filesystems (RAID/LVM, NFS/SMB, iSCSI) and enforce quotas and permissions.
- Ensure reliable backup & restore operations (Veeam/Bacula/Commvault); perform periodic restore tests with documented evidence.
- Maintain certificates (TLS/PKI), time/NTP, syslog/Winlog forwarding, and OS logging to SIEM.
- Implement and monitor server observability (metrics/logs/alerts) and publish availability/utilization reports.
- Support application teams with environment setup, service configuration, and deployment/change activities via CAB.
- Conduct DR/BCP drills for server layers aligned with RTO/RPO; maintain up-to-date runbooks and CMDB records.
- Automate operational tasks using PowerShell/Bash (and Ansible where applicable); maintain HLD/LLD and SOP documentation.
